I am looking at signatures for Arrow and Composable classes and I cannot understand some of them. Could you please explain me the following: Let's take for example the following: class FunAble h => FunDble h where resultFun :: (h b -> h b') -> (h (a->b) -> h (a->b')) class FunAble h where secondFun :: (h b -> h b') -> (h (a,b) -> h (a,b')) -- for 'second' in the signatures: resultFun :: (h b -> h b') -> (h (a->b) -> h (a->b')) secondFun :: (h b -> h b') -> (h (a,b) -> h (a,b')) if (h b -> h b') is the input of these functions where does 'a' comes from in the output?
